2021/063: The Last House on Needless Street -- Catriona Ward
Killing things is hard, sure, but keeping them safe and alive is much more difficult. Oh boy, do I know about that. [loc. 256]

Ted Bannerman lives in a house with boarded-up windows, the last house on Needless Street. He shares the house with his daughter Lauren and his cat Olivia, both of whom narrate chapters in this novel. Ted is not like other people: it's hard to tell whether he has learning disabilities, or is on the autism spectrum, or is simply misunderstood. He labels people by characteristic rather than name: the Bug-Man, the Chihuahua Lady, the Little Girl with Popsicle. Eleven years before, when Little Girl with Popsicle went missing at the nearby lake, he became the town's scapegoat. Was Ted responsible for the girl's disappearance? Quite a few children have gone missing over the years.
